Web• Cover, date, and refrigerate cut tomatoes. Use by the following day for best quality. • Hold and serve cut tomatoes at 41 °F. Do not store cut tomatoes at room temperature. Take and record serving line temperatures of cut tomatoes. • Discard cut tomatoes after 2 hours in the temperature danger zone (41 °F to 135 °F).
